  • complementation test — A genetic method to test whether or not independent mutations are allelic. In a cross between the two mutant individuals, the genotype will be m1m2 if the mutations are allelic and m1 +/+ m2 if non allelic. The phenotype of the former will be… …   Glossary of Biotechnology
